Subject: Monthly partitioning lands tonight

Hey release folks — quick note for Tamsin's security review: the Orvane billing tables are now partitioned by month, so the retention job drops whole partitions instead of row-deleting. Access paths are unchanged; the partition router runs inside the existing service role. Old partitions get archived before drop, so nothing vanishes silently. Audit against the build token that follows.

session token of yajof-bagef = htk4_937d

## Authentication

The Pairloom matching service occasionally exhibits garbage-collection pauses of 400–900 ms under peak load, which can cause auth handshakes to time out and retry. This is expected; the retry layer absorbs it. If you see more than three consecutive handshake failures, the pause is likely longer than the GC budget and you should capture a heap dump before restarting. All authenticated calls go through the Kestrelgate internal endpoint, which validates requests using the service key shown on the next line.

API key for kahop-bagef: zpat2_yb

## Escalation: Cold Starts on Lanternfish Handlers

Cold-start latency on the Lanternfish serverless tier should stay under 900ms at p95. If the dashboard shows sustained breaches for more than two deploy windows, check whether the pre-warm scheduler is running; it frequently dies after a region failover. Restarting the scheduler resolves most cases. If latency remains elevated after restart, treat it as a platform regression and raise it with the runtime squad immediately.

billing contact of kagaf-bahif = fraox_ralvan_tamwyn@zemvarcloud.local